I'd give it an XF-40.
Wear is showing on the tips of the wheat ears.

And I think that's a die scratch which, like a die crack, will have only a minor effect on the grade.

If it is a die scratch it will be raised on the coin. As large as it is, it should be easy to determine in hand. Appears to be incuse from the pictures, but I have had pictures play tricks on me before. Interested to know, that would be a big die scratch.
